About Lower Delaware Archers

Lower Delaware Archers, based in Georgetown near the state's southern beach corridor, pairs USA Archery affiliation with both a Junior Olympic Archery Development program and an Adult Archery Program, covering younger competitive hopefuls and grown-up beginners in one club. Sussex County sees seasonal population swings tied to the nearby shore towns, and a structured, affiliated club gives year-round residents a consistent option beyond whatever pops up during summer tourist season. Running both a JOAD track and adult instruction under one roof means the club isn't just feeding a junior pipeline, it's set up to bring first-time adult archers up to speed.
